资源简介
WSN matlab 代码 算法 无线传感器网络仿真代码
代码片段和文件信息
function [xminf] = CmpSimpleMthd(AcbbaseVector)
sz = size(A);
nVia = sz(2);
n = sz(1);
xx = 1:nVia;
nobase = zeros(11);
m = 1;
if c>=0
vr = find(c~=0 1‘last‘);
rgv = inv(A(:(nVia-n+1):nVia))*b;
if rgv >=0
x = zeros(1vr);
minf = 0;
else
disp(‘不存在最优解!‘);
x = NaN;
minf = NaN;
return;
end
end
for i=1:nVia
if(isempty(find(baseVector == xx(i)1)))
nobase(m) = i;
m = m + 1;
else
;
end
end
bCon = 1;
M = 0;
while bCon
nB = A(:nobase);
ncb = c(nobase);
B = A(:baseVector);
cb = c(baseVector);
xb = inv(B)*b;
f = cb*xb;
w = cb*inv(B);
for i=1:length(nobase)
sigma(i) = w*nB(:i)-ncb(i);
end
[maxsind] = max(sigma);
if maxs <= 0
minf = cb*xb;
vr = find(c~=0 1‘last‘);
for l=1:vr
ele = find(baseVector == l1);
if(isempty(ele))
x(l) = 0;
else
x(l)=xb(ele);
end
end
bCon = 0;
else
y = inv(B)*A(:nobase(ind));
if y <= 0
disp(‘不存在最优解!‘);
else
minb = inf;
chagB = 0;
for j=1:length(y)
if y(j)>0
bz = xb(j)/y(j);
if bz minb = bz;
chagB = j;
end
end
end
tmp = baseVector(chagB);
baseVector(chagB) = nobase(ind);
nobase(ind) = tmp;
end
end
M = M + 1;
if (M == 1000000)
disp(‘找不到最优解!‘);
x = NaN;
minf = NaN;
return;
end
end
属性 大小 日期 时间 名称
----------- --------- ---------- ----- ----
文件 1836 2008-05-28 19:54 光盘程序\第10章 线性规划\CmpSimpleMthd.m
文件 2269 2008-06-01 15:22 光盘程序\第10章 线性规划\ModifSimpleMthd.m
文件 1645 2008-05-28 19:56 光盘程序\第10章 线性规划\SimpleMthd.m
文件 4789 2008-06-29 22:39 光盘程序\第11章 整数规划\DividePlane.m
文件 2833 2008-07-06 16:39 光盘程序\第11章 整数规划\IntProgFZ.m
文件 1141 2008-06-30 21:39 光盘程序\第11章 整数规划\ZeroOneprog.m
文件 2311 2008-06-02 19:42 光盘程序\第12章 二次规划\ActivdeSet.m
文件 226 2008-06-02 20:18 光盘程序\第12章 二次规划\QuadLagR.m
文件 1180 2008-06-02 20:16 光盘程序\第12章 二次规划\TrackRoute.m
文件 1085 2008-09-04 18:35 光盘程序\第13章 粒子群优化算法\AsyLnCPSO.m
文件 1829 2008-09-10 20:12 光盘程序\第13章 粒子群优化算法\BreedPSO.m
文件 2413 2008-09-13 01:21 光盘程序\第13章 粒子群优化算法\CLSPSO.m
文件 1028 2008-09-02 20:11 光盘程序\第13章 粒子群优化算法\LinWPSO.m
文件 1017 2008-09-04 18:32 光盘程序\第13章 粒子群优化算法\LnCPSO.m
文件 971 2008-09-02 20:11 光盘程序\第13章 粒子群优化算法\PSO.m
文件 1116 2008-09-03 20:43 光盘程序\第13章 粒子群优化算法\RandWPSO.m
文件 1156 2008-09-11 21:21 光盘程序\第13章 粒子群优化算法\SAPSO.m
文件 1073 2008-09-03 20:51 光盘程序\第13章 粒子群优化算法\SecPSO.m
文件 1438 2008-09-03 21:00 光盘程序\第13章 粒子群优化算法\SecVibratPSO.m
文件 1173 2008-09-10 19:51 光盘程序\第13章 粒子群优化算法\SelPSO.m
文件 1584 2008-09-04 21:02 光盘程序\第13章 粒子群优化算法\SimuAPSO.m
文件 1175 2008-09-02 20:13 光盘程序\第13章 粒子群优化算法\YSPSO.m
文件 2579 2008-09-10 21:32 光盘程序\第14章 遗传优化算法\AdapGA.m
文件 2380 2008-09-10 21:33 光盘程序\第14章 遗传优化算法\DblGEGA.m
文件 2889 2008-09-13 14:14 光盘程序\第14章 遗传优化算法\GMGA.m
文件 3344 2008-09-05 21:46 光盘程序\第14章 遗传优化算法\MMAdapGA.m
文件 2426 2008-09-13 13:08 光盘程序\第14章 遗传优化算法\myGA.m
文件 2070 2008-09-13 13:42 光盘程序\第14章 遗传优化算法\NormFitGA.m
文件 2571 2008-09-13 13:27 光盘程序\第14章 遗传优化算法\SBOGA.m
文件 1045 2007-10-06 15:07 光盘程序\第6章 无约束一维极值问题\minFBNQ.m
............此处省略42个文件信息
相关资源
- matlab——PSO算法以及两种适应度函数
- 基于纹理的图像检索源码matlab
- matlab实现了图像通信中的全搜索算法
- Win7下MATLAB_7.0地址和详细安装+汉化包
- 乘同余法产生M序列的matlab源程序
- 广义霍夫变换的MATLAB源码
- matlab轮廓匹配的物体识别系统
- JPEG2000MATLAB代码
- matlab 图像离散余弦变换(源代码)
- 六自由度机器人避障问题的MATLAB仿真
- Matlab混沌工具箱
- 空间球拟合程序Matlab
- 信道估计的matlab仿真
- 基于matlab的数字图像处理论文
- 基于DTW语音识别matlab代码
- 质心定位算法MATLAB仿真
- 蚁群算法求解旅行商最优路径问题
- AR参数模型功率谱估计仿真程序
- MATLAB样例之雅克比迭代法
- 快速人脸定位matlab程序
- B样条弹性配准matlab
- bp算法 matlab实现 图像分类
- matlab2010b破解文件,lisensce,序列号
- matlab实现的粒子群动态寻路算法
- MATLAB写的scm信道程序
- 求图像边缘像素最短距离
- MATLAB 学生信息管理系统
- 一个简单的自适应控制matlab
- MATLAB实现人体识别
- Matlab特征向量归一化
评论
共有 条评论